Understanding the Complexity of Audi Key Technology
Before diving into the replacement procedure, it is essential to comprehend why these keys are so specialized. Audi uses a multi-layered security method that incorporates mechanical parts with encrypted electronic signals.
Modern Audi Key Types
Depending upon the year and model of the automobile, the lost key most likely falls into one of three classifications:
- The Flip (Switchblade) Key: Common in designs from the late 1990s to the mid-2000s. These feature a physical blade that turns out of the fob and needs to be placed into the ignition.
- The Advanced Key (Smart Key): Found in many contemporary Audis. This permits proximity entry and push-to-start functionality. The key interacts with the automobile's ECU (Engine Control Unit) by means of encrypted radio frequencies.
- The Emergency Key: A plastic or slim metal key typically saved inside the fob or provided individually, created to open the door manually if the electronic system fails.
The Role of the Immobilizer System
Because the late 1990s, Audi automobiles have actually been geared up with an immobilizer system. This system includes an RFID chip embedded in the key head and an antenna around the ignition cylinder (or inside the dash for keyless systems). If the vehicle does not recognize the distinct digital signature of the key, the fuel system is handicapped, and the car will not begin. Replacing a lost key is not merely about "cutting metal"; it is mainly about "programs data."
Immediate Steps to Take After Losing an Audi Key
If an owner discovers themselves without their secrets, they should follow a structured approach to guarantee a speedy resolution.
1. Confirmation of Loss
Before starting an expensive replacement, a comprehensive search of all possible places is needed. Motorists need to also check if a spare key was offered in the original purchase paperwork or saved at a relative's home.
2. Find the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N)
To order a new key or have one set, the VIN is required. The VIN can typically be discovered in the following locations:
- The driver's side dashboard (noticeable through the windscreen).
- The motorist's side door jamb.
- Lorry registration or insurance coverage files.
3. Proof of Ownership
To prevent auto-theft, dealers and expert locksmiths will require legal evidence of ownership. This generally consists of a legitimate chauffeur's license and the automobile's title or registration.
Replacement Options: Dealership vs. Mobile Locksmith
When a key is lost, owners usually have two primary options for replacement. The choice often depends on the level of urgency and the budget.
Comparison Table: Dealership vs. Independent Locksmith
| Feature | Audi Dealership | Mobile Automotive Locksmith |
|---|---|---|
| Convenience | Low (Requires hauling the car to the dealer) | High (They concern the lorry's location) |
| Equipment | Factory-grade fixed diagnostics | Specialized mobile programs tools |
| Speed | 2-- 5 company days (Key should be purchased) | Same day (Often within 1-- 2 hours) |
| Price | Premium/ High | Competitive/ Moderate |
| Assurance | Manufacturer-backed guarantee | Variable (Depends on the locksmith professional) |
Option 1: The Local Audi Dealership
The dealer is the most standard path. They buy a key pre-cut to the vehicle's VIN straight from the manufacturer in Germany or a central center. When the key shows up, the automobile should be hauled to the service center so the service technicians can connect the brand-new key to the automobile's immobilizer by means of a safe server connection to Audi's head office.
Alternative 2: Specialized Automotive Locksmiths
A specialized locksmith professional who concentrates on European lorries can often provide a faster solution. These professionals carry "blank" Audi keys and use sophisticated software to bypass or interface with the car's security system. Because they are mobile, they eliminate the need for an expensive tow truck. However, owners need to ensure the locksmith has the specific software needed for Audi's "Component Protection" systems.
The Factors Influencing Replacement Costs
Changing an Audi key is more costly than replacing keys for numerous other brands. Several variables dictate the final billing.
Approximated Cost Breakdown by Model Generation
| Audi Generation/ Year | Approximated Cost (Key + Programming) |
|---|---|
| Pre-2005 (Fixed or Flip Keys) | ₤ 150-- ₤ 250 |
| 2005-- 2015 (Transponder/Basic Fob) | ₤ 250-- ₤ 450 |
| 2016-- Present (Advanced Smart Keys) | ₤ 450-- ₤ 800+ |
| High-Performance Models (RS/R8) | ₤ 600-- ₤ 1,000 |
Expense Variables
- Emergency Service: Requesting a key on a weekend, holiday, or late in the evening will sustain "after-hours" charges from locksmiths.
- All Keys Lost vs. Spare Key: If the owner has at least one here working key, the cost of "cloning" it is much lower. If all keys are lost, the technician needs to carry out a "fresh" shows, which is substantially more complex.
- Geographic Location: Labor rates in major cities are generally higher than in rural regions.
Preventative Measures for Audi Owners
To avoid the logistical headache of a lost key, Audi owners should consider the following proactive actions:
- Duplicate Early: The expense of producing a spare while a working key exists is often 50% less than creating one when all secrets are lost.
- Bluetooth Trackers: Attaching a Tile or Apple AirTag to the key ring permits owners to find their keys via a mobile phone app.
- Key Insurance: Many contemporary extensive insurance policies or extended warranties use "Key Replacement Coverage" as an add-on.
- Digital Key Options: On some more recent Audi designs, the Audi connect ® system enables smart device combination, which can in some cases act as a secondary method of entry or start, though this varies significantly by area and design year.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
Can I buy a used Audi key fob on eBay and program it myself?
Generally, no. The majority of Audi key fobs are "locked" to the VIN of the initial car when configured. In addition, programming an Audi key needs access to Audi's exclusive software application (ODIS) or high-end aftermarket diagnostic tools. DIY shows is hardly ever possible for contemporary Audi designs.
Does my car insurance cover lost keys?
This depends upon the particular policy. Standard liability insurance does not cover lost secrets, however numerous "Premium" or "Comprehensive" strategies include a key replacement rider. It is suggested for owners to inspect their policy information.
What if my Audi key is stuck in the ignition?
This is frequently an indication of a failing ignition cylinder or a dead vehicle battery. Motorists must not force the key out, as this can harm the internal wafers of the lock. A locksmith professional or service technician ought to be called to detect whether the problem is mechanical or electrical.
How long does it consider a locksmith professional to make an Audi key?
On average, a specialized locksmith can cut and set a new Audi key in 45 to 90 minutes, supplied they have the right blank in stock.
